Judge approves Dewey estate's settlement with former chairman, insurer

A bankruptcy judge approved a settlement Thursday between the Dewey & LeBoeuf LLP estate, the firm's former chairman, Steven H. Davis, and XL Specialty Insurance Corp., the former firm's primary insurer.

A bankruptcy judge approved a settlement Thursday between the Dewey & LeBoeuf LLP estate, the firm's former chairman, Steven H. Davis, and XL Specialty Insurance Corp., the former firm's primary insurer.
